MORE SMALL-POX.
CASES IN THE SOUTH. By Telegraph.—Press Association. ' Dunedin, Last Nighf. Two fresh cases qf American small'pox were notified to-day to the. health officer for Qtago and Southland, making a total to date since the outbreak was notified of 51 cases, namely 2? m southland and 22 in Otago. The total number of cases under treatment in Dunedin is eleven and fifteen in Southland. The health officer advises vaccination* and many school children are being vaccinated.
